The Action Of Anhydrous Aluminium Chloride Upon Unsaturated Organic Compounds is a scientific book written by Wilmer Charles Gangloff and published in 1917. The book explores the chemical reactions that occur when unsaturated organic compounds are exposed to anhydrous aluminium chloride, a powerful Lewis acid. Gangloff's research focuses on the effects of this reaction on various types of organic compounds, including alkenes, alkynes, and aromatic compounds. The book contains detailed descriptions of the experimental methods used to study these reactions, as well as the results and conclusions drawn from the research.
